Ballad Illustrated by Alea MarleyA New York Times Best Illustrated Childrens Book of 2013! Ballad is a story. It is also a narrative song, and like all great stories, it deepens with each retelling. Ballad builds over seven sequences. The first has three images: school, path, home. The next builds upon the first, giving us: school, street, path, forest, home.
